Spacecraft Mechanisms

Propulsion Thruster Drive Mechanism

  • Purpose: Rotation of the unit consisting of three propulsion thrusters around one axis within the specified angle range, holding the thruster unit in the transportation position during the launch phase and operating temperature control of propulsion thrusters.
  • Year of release: 2003
  • Guaranteed service life (years): 15
  • Estimated production / delivery time (months): 4
ParameterValue
Rotation angles of the engine installation surfaces, °±10.5
Rotation rate of the engine installation surfaces, °/min0.08 – 5
Pointing error, arcmin, not exceeding5
Nominal developed torque, N·m, not less than20
Operating temperature range, °С-50 to +50
Operational life defined by hours, not less than14000
Active lifetime, years15
Overall guaranteed lifetime, years19
Overall dimensions, mm520 x 390 x 300
Mass, kg7.3

One-degree-of-freedom electromechanical device for rotation of spacecraft propulsion thrusters.
